Guwahati, April 27 (NationPress) Assam Chief Minister Himanta Biswa Sarma has once again launched an assault on Gaurav Gogoi, the Deputy Leader of Congress in the Lok Sabha, regarding allegations of his supposed connections to Pakistan, triggering a fierce backlash from the opposition party.

“In Assam, we only have one individual linked to Pakistan. She is married to a local family in Sukhi district and has applied for a long-term visa, although she originally hails from Pakistan,” the Chief Minister remarked to reporters.

The Chief Minister further stated that the state government has requested the Union government to determine whether she should be repatriated.

“Aside from her, there are no Pakistani nationals in Assam,” he emphasized.

A Special Investigation Team (SIT) from the Assam Police is currently probing the connections between Gaurav Gogoi's wife and the Pakistani national and climate policy expert Ali Tauqeer Sheikh. This investigation comes amidst ongoing attacks from Assam Chief Minister Himanta Biswa and the BJP against Gogoi over his wife's alleged ties to Pakistan's intelligence agency, ISI.

In response, Gogoi has dismissed these allegations as a tactic by the BJP to distract from various land scandals involving his family.

Meanwhile, Congress has retaliated against the Chief Minister, accusing him of crossing all bounds of decency in light of the Pahalgam attack.

“Politics has seen many unscrupulous individuals, particularly within the BJP. The Chief Minister of Assam has surpassed all standards of decency by leveraging a sensitive border situation to settle personal political scores. Gaurav Gogoi does not need validation of his patriotism from a corrupt individual. Himanta Biswa has much to conceal, while Gaurav has much to reveal,” stated Pawan Khera, Congress Chairman of the Media & Publicity Department, on X.

Congress General Secretary (Organisation) K C Venugopal declared that the Chief Minister’s 'pathetic' and 'below-the-belt' remarks regarding Gaurav Gogoi demonstrate that he is unfit for public office.

“His unfounded attacks on Gaurav Gogoi's family, questioning their loyalty, are attempts to divert attention from the serious corruption allegations he must address. Unity against Pakistan is crucial at this time,” he wrote on X.

Venugopal continued, asserting that by frivolously invoking the Pakistan narrative against a principled leader like Gogoi, who has been vocally opposing the Chief Minister, Biswa only strengthens their adversaries and confirms his inability to respond credibly to the overwhelming evidence of corruption against him.

“Gaurav Gogoi is a principled leader confronting the might of a police state, and we firmly support him,” he affirmed.

However, Biswa remained steadfast, countering Venugopal’s post on X by stating that his claims are rooted in factual evidence.

“No, sir. I want to reiterate with complete responsibility and authority that everything I've said is backed by verifiable facts and 100% authentic information. This is not mere rhetoric; it is a factual assertion made following thorough investigation,” he wrote on X.

Biswa requested the concerned Member of Parliament to clarify the following inquiries: “Did you or did you not spend 15 consecutive days in Pakistan? Please confirm or deny unequivocally. 2. What is the citizenship status of your minor children? Are they exclusively Indian citizens, or do they hold any foreign nationality? 3. Is it true that your wife received a salary from a Pakistan-based NGO, allegedly linked to Pakistani agencies, while simultaneously employed by a separate NGO registered in India?”

The Chief Minister asserted that these are legitimate questions arising from facts in the public interest, adding that more inquiries will emerge in due time.

“Our investigation continues, conducted responsibly and based solely on facts and documents. It has nothing to do with any personal attacks or below-the-belt political statements,” the Chief Minister concluded.
